AN IMPORTANT DECISION

lIUAINAWE CLASSIFICATION.

ONLY ONE LIST PERMISSIBLE.

A decision of. Dominion-wide importance was given by Mr Wyvern Wilson, S.M., in the Morrinsville Court on Thursday, when objections te : the classification list of- the Tauhei Drainage; Board were being heard. The board had recently raised a sum of £4900 by way of special loan for a comprehensive drainage scheme within its district, and a special classification list of the land within the beard's area was prepared as the; basis of rating for the interest and sinking fund on the loan, At the same time a general classification list of the land within the board’s area was prepared as the basis fofr general rating purposes. His Worship held that thep-e could be only one classification list in existence at ope time in any drainage district. Af.t,er the magistrate had gven his ruling Mr McGregor quoted a passage from the Gazette Law Reports in the case of the Western Taieri Land; Drainage Board v. Gow, in which His Honour Judgje Sim held: “The concluding words of section 35 of the Land Drainage Act, 1908, make it clear that, speaking generally, there can be only one classification in force in a district at one time.” This decision was in conformity .with His Worship’s ruling. At this stage the Court jvas adjourned and a conference of solicitors was held, also a meeting, off the Drainage Board to consider the pew sltuar tion created by the magistrate’s decision. ( Op resuming, Mr McGregor intimated, on behalf Cjf the board 1 , that both Hats would be withdrawn in the meantime, and one fresh classification list prepared in accordance with the Act.
